Blockchain-Based Game MetalCore Receives $5 Million in Latest Funding Round

The videogame developer Studio369’s has successfully raised $5 million in the latest funding round for its upcoming web3 MMO, MetalCore. As detailed in the press release provided to Cryptonews.com, the March 12 funding round saw contributions from notable investors such as Delphi Digital, BITKRAFT Ventures, and Sanctor Capital alongside other backers supporting Studio369’s vision. Nexon’s MMORPG MapleStory to Launch Web3 Version on Avalanche

Nexon, the South Korean video game developer, plans to launch a web3 version of MapleStory on the Avalanche blockchain, adding user-generated content and new gameplay mechanics. Axie Infinity Co-Founder Losses Over $10 Million In Hack, AXS Holds Firm

Two personal crypto wallets belonging to Jeff “Jihoz” Zirlin, the co-founder of Sky Mavis, the company behind the popular play-to-earn (P2E) game Axie Infinity, have been compromised, reports on February 23 show. Web3 Game Developer Wemade Reports Widening Losses in Q4 2023

South Korean Web3 game developer Wemade has disclosed a significant increase in operating and net losses in the fourth quarter of last year, as per its latest earnings report. Web3 Gaming Firm Immutable Opens zkEVM Mainnet Early Access with Polygon

Gods Unchained developer Immutable launched early access for its zkEVM Mainnet powered by Polygon on Monday. In the early access period, a mainnet deployer allowlist will be in place to guarantee operational smoothness and user security. Sega to Develop New Web3 Games, Reveals Partnership With Finschia

Sega Singapore, a subsidiary of the worldwide recognized entertainment company, has announced that it will seek to produce new Web3 games as part of a partnership established with Finschia, a blockchain project. South Korean Gaming Giant WeMade Must Pay $41M ‘Crypto Tax’ Bill

Source: Zerbor/Adobe The South Korean gaming firm WeMade has been hit with a $41 million tax bill for its crypto-related activities. Yonhap reported that the National Tax Service (NTS) issued the bill following an investigation into the firm’s historic crypto business operations.
